

- extensive knowledge
-
- extensive knowledge
-
- extensive knowledge
-
- extensive experience/coverage
-
- extensive search/inquiries
-
- extensive
-
- extensive
-
- extensive
-




- extensive repair
-
- extensive damage
-


- extensive repair
-
- extensive damage
-
- extensive damage